Set in a fabulous flat central village location with amenities including Gym, Primary School, Nursery's, Church, Florist, Wine Bar, Country Store, Indian Restaurant, Pet Shop, Heating and Lighting Shops and Bus stop directly Stockport, Buxton and Manchester airport all within 150 meters.
Bowling Club, Memorial Park, Cock Hotel, Co-Op Food store, Café, Dog Groomers, Bike Shop, Butchers, Hairdressers and Italian restaurant all within 300 meters.
Railways station within 400 meters with direct routes to Manchester and Buxton.
Further amenities within 600 meters including Dentist, Pharmacy, Medical Centre, Library, Builders Merchant, Fish and Chip Shop, Town Hall, Canal Basin, Vet, Printing Sop and Kitchen and Bathroom shop.
On the doorstep of the beautiful Peak District, this property is set in the ideal location with the Goyt Valley, Fernilee and the canal basin all within close proximity.

The property itself is a spacious detached family home, with accommodation briefly comprising: Entrance porch, entrance hallway, two reception rooms, dining kitchen, rear hallway, downstairs WC ,double garage/ workshop and laundry room to the ground floor with five bedrooms (three ensuite) and family bathroom to the first floor with separate WC. Cellar to the lower ground floor.
Externally the property has driveway parking for several vehicles leading to the garage, to the front of the property there is a large garden laid with slate with boarders and pathway. Gated access leading to the rear garden. The rear garden is laid with both patio and decking with steps leading to a further garden overlooking the river Goyt and waterfall. There is a further outdoor timber building currently used as a home office.

Benefitting from new gas central heating, new internal and external decoration and hard wood double glazing. Viewing is highly recommended to fully appreciate the size, location and plot of this property.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
